Skip to content

anni-hilation/Russian-Roulette-Discord-Bot

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

13 Commits
 
 
 
 
 
 

Repository files navigation

Russian Roulette Discord Bot
I will try to find a free hosting service so that this bot can be installed in your guilds/servers.
I cant find shit. I wish i had a raspberrry pi so badddddduh.
Current state: not hosted
https://discord.com/oauth2/authorize?client_id=1457398787550220566&permissions=1101659180038&integration_type=0&scope=bot+applications.commands

Commands:

/russian_roulete
/help
/check_roles

When using /help, the following text shows up:

    🎲 Russian Roulette Bot Help

    Commands:
    /russian_roulette - Start a game. Users can type "Me!" to join and "Done." to finish player selection.
    /help - Get help.
    /check_roles - Check if bots role is high enough to reliably mute/kick/ban members.

    Game Rules:
    Minimum 2 players, maximum 10 players per game.
    Only the person who started the game can type "Done."
    The bot will randomly select a loser.

    Punishments:
    Easy: 5-minute mute
    Medium: Kick
    Hard: Ban

    ⚠️ The bot cannot mute, kick or ban the server owner.

When using /russian_roulette, you are required to pick the "difficulty"
Easy = loser gets muted for 5 mins
Medium = loser gets kicked
Hard = loser gets banned
After executing the command 2-10 Players have to type "Me!" in Chat to join.
"Done." is typed to finish the player-selection. Only the person, who ran the command can use "Done.".
Both "Done." and "Me!" case and symbol sensitive to Prevent accidental Input.
The Server owner cannot join.

When using /check_roles the bot measures if there are any roles above it.
If there are, its going to show an "Error" and prompt you to move the roles below it. 
The bot only needs to be above the roles that potential players might have.
If you want to make people, like for example mods/admins immortal,
simply move their role above the bots and ignore the warning.

-------------------------------------------------------------------------------------

Relied medium-heavily on chatGPT for this one but im definetly starting to learn.





About

Discord bot that pickes a random user and mutes/kicks/bans them.

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ages